OREF celebrates 60th anniversary: 3 things to know

The Orthopaedic Research and Education Foundation marked its 60th anniversary in September 2015, kicking off a celebration that will culminate in March.

Here are three things to know:

 

1. Founded in 1955, the foundation has maintained its focus on funding research in orthopedics.

 

2. The foundation has provided more than $142 million in funding to more than 4,700 individuals and institutions over the last 60 years.

 

3. The 60-year anniversary celebration will culminate with special events at the 2016 AAOS Annual Meeting in Orlando, Fla.
